Bojour,
je me suis apreçu
d'un truc bizarre dans ma gestion automatiser de sauvegarde (tar) avec
cron.
Je veux faire
plusieurs paquets pour graver si besoin indépendemment mes
rep.
J'ai le bash suivant
:
#! /bin/bash
cd /home/
echo APPLI
tar cvzf /tmp/appli.tar.gz appli
echo SCANS
tar cvzf /tmp/docs.tar.gz docs
echo DOCU
tar cvzf /tmp/docu.tar.gz docu
echo PHOTO
tar cvzf /tmp/photo.tar.gz photo
echo DATAS
tar cvzf /tmp/datas.tar.gz datas
echo Fin
cd /home/
echo APPLI
tar cvzf /tmp/appli.tar.gz appli
echo SCANS
tar cvzf /tmp/docs.tar.gz docs
echo DOCU
tar cvzf /tmp/docu.tar.gz docu
echo PHOTO
tar cvzf /tmp/photo.tar.gz photo
echo DATAS
tar cvzf /tmp/datas.tar.gz datas
echo Fin
Lorsque je lance mon
bash en ligne de commande, "/etc/bash", tout ce passe correctement, il créé tous
les .tar.gz dans /tmp.
Dans le cron par
contre, le
résultat est que la première ligne marche et les autres sont
regroupés.
Dans /tmp, je trouve
:
- appli.tar.gz du
04/11/2004
- backup_other....tar.gz du
04/11/2004
pas de fichier docs..., docu...,
datas....
Merci
d'avance